How they compare

Syrian Arab Republic currently reports 48.9% against 44.6% in Nicaragua, a difference of 4.3%.

That makes Syrian Arab Republic's figure about 1.1 times Nicaragua's.

Across all 9 years both countries report, Syrian Arab Republic has been ahead every year.

Nicaragua ranks 128th and Syrian Arab Republic ranks 125th of 152 countries.

Syrian Arab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Nicaragua Syrian Arab Republic Difference Ahead
1970s 11.9% 37.8% 25.9% Syrian Arab Republic
1980s 17.9% 53.3% 35.4% Syrian Arab Republic
2000s 36.9% 53.1% 16.2% Syrian Arab Republic
2010s 44.6% 66.6% 22.0% Syrian Arab Republic

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Net enrollment rate is the ratio of children of official school age who are enrolled in school to the population of the corresponding official school age. Secondary education completes the provision of basic education that began at the primary level, and aims at laying the foundations for lifelong learning and human development, by offering more subject- or skill-oriented instruction using more specialized teachers.
